Apple Valley revises early-person voting

Apple Valley has announced a revised schedule for its early in-person voting sites.

From 10 a.m. to 6 p.m. Oct. 26 through Oct. 30, the town’s recreation center will host early voting for the upcoming general election, according to a statement on the town’s website.

The recreation center is at Apple Valley Town Hall, 14955 Dale Evans Parkway.

Voting at all Apple Valley polling places will take place Oct. 31-Nov. 2  from 10 a.m. to 6 p.m., and on election day,  Nov. 3,  from 7 a.m. to 8 p.m. To register to vote, or to find your polling place, visit www.sbcountyelections.com or call (909) 387-8300.

Residents are encouraged to vote by Oct. 19, but anyone may conditionally register to vote and cast a provisional ballot in person at any time up to and including election day.

Because of COVID-19, all California registered voters will receive a vote-by-mail ballot beginning Oct 5, according to the statement.
